A telescopic loader, also known as a telescopic arm loader or conveyor, integrates multiple functions such as forklifts, cranes, and small loaders; It can not only use the front-end fork to accurately pick up and transport goods like traditional forklifts, but also easily handle the loading and unloading of palletized goods; It can also utilize the telescopic and variable amplitude functions of the boom to achieve high-altitude lifting operations similar to cranes, lifting heavy objects to designated positions; Used in various industries, including construction, agriculture, and material handling, to perform various tasks.

With its extendable arm, Telehandler has excellent horizontal and vertical job coverage. In the horizontal direction, the arm can span a large distance when extended. In warehousing and logistics, goods can be transported from the warehouse to distant transport vehicles; Vertically, it can lift goods to a considerable height. In construction, building materials can be lifted to high floors of multi story buildings to meet various high-altitude operation needs.

Some high-end models of telescopic forklifts are equipped with advanced intelligent assistance systems, such as automatic leveling function, which can automatically adjust the equipment posture during operation, ensuring that the forks are always in a horizontal state and improving the safety and stability of cargo handling; There is also an overload protection system. When the equipment detects that the weight of the lifted goods exceeds the rated load, it will immediately issue an alarm and limit related actions to avoid safety accidents caused by overload, greatly improving the level of intelligence and safety of operation.
